Highlights
Are people in Portage older or younger than people in Granger?
- The Median Age in Portage is 2.8 years younger than in Granger.

Are housing costs cheaper in Portage or Granger?
- Portage housing costs are 29.0% less expensive than Granger hous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Portage or Granger?
- The average commute for residents of Portage is 3.3 minutes longer than it is for residents of Granger.
